Hiring for Python Developer - HyderabadJob Summary:We are looking for a skilled and motivated Python Developer to join our team. You will be responsible for developing scalable backend services, APIs, and applications using Python, ensuring robust performance, quality, and responsiveness to requests from the front-end.Key Responsibilities:Design, develop, test, and deploy high-quality Python applications.Build and maintain RESTful APIs and microservices.Collaborate with front-end developers, product managers, and designers to deliver solutions.Optimize applications for performance, scalability, and reliability.Integrate with third-party APIs, databases, and data pipelines.Participate in code reviews and maintain best practices in code quality and security.Write clear and maintainable documentation.Required Qualifications:Bachelor's degree in Computer Science, Engineering, or a related field (or equivalent experience).Proficiency in Python 3.x and relevant frameworks (e.g., Flask, Django, FastAPI).Experience with SQL/NoSQL databases (e.g., PostgreSQL, MySQL, MongoDB).Familiarity with version control systems (e.g., Git).Understanding of object-oriented programming, design patterns, and software development principles.Experience working with APIs, asynchronous programming, and unit testing.Preferred Qualifications:Experience with Docker, Kubernetes, or other containerization tools.Familiarity with cloud platforms like AWS, GCP, or Azure.Knowledge of CI/CD pipelines and automated testing tools.Exposure to data processing or machine learning frameworks (e.g., Pandas, NumPy, TensorFlow).Knowledge of frontend technologies (HTML, CSS, JavaScript) is a plus.